CodiMD
CodiMDは、もちろんMarkdownとの互換性に加えて、リアルタイムコラボレーションを提供するオープンソースエディターです。
前書き
Markdownを使用してドキュメントを編集することで、開発チームとリアルタイムで、そして最高のコラボレーションを可能にする強力なツール。
CodiMDは、HackMDソースコードに基づいて構築されています。
このツールを使用すると、プロジェクトのコンテンツを簡単にホストおよび制御できます。
CodiMDでのMarkdownのサポートは優れており、CommonMarkの構文とも互換性があります。
ツールのいくつかの興味深いplugins:
- MathJax - 数式をレンダリングするために使用します。
- Mermaid & Graphviz – UMLの図解。
- Vega-lite - データを表示する必要がある人のために。
- Emojis - ドキュメントにもう少し表現を加えること。
CodiMDの公式ウェブサイトはhttps://github.com/hackmdio/codimdです。
CodiMDでのMarkdownのサポート
表1.1は、CodiMDと互換性のあるMarkdown要素を示しています。
素子 | サポート | 情報 |
---|---|---|
タイトル | うん | このツールは、Markdownでタイトルを作成するための代替構文をサポートしていません。 |
段落 | うん | |
改行 | うん | コンテンツの右側の空白を使用して行を区切ると、CodiMDでフォーマットの問題が発生する可能性がありますが、Enter は引き続きサポートされます。キーを押すだけで、新しい行を挿入できます。 |
大胆な | うん | |
イタリック | うん | |
Blockquote | うん | blockquotesをネストすると、フォーマットエラーが発生する可能性もあります。CodiMDはネストされたblockquotesと互換性がありません。 |
注文リスト | うん | |
順序付けられていないリスト | うん | |
コード | うん | |
水平線 | うん | |
Links | うん | |
画像 | うん | |
テーブル | うん | |
フェンスで囲まれたコードブロック | うん | プログラミング言語に応じてブロックコードを強調表示することができます。 |
脚注 | うん | |
タイトルID | 番号 | |
定義リスト | うん | |
取り消し線 | うん | |
タスクリスト | うん | |
Emoji (コピーアンドペースト) | うん | |
Emoji (アクセスコード) | うん | |
URLの自動Link | うん | |
URLの自動linkを無効にする | 番号 | |
HTML | うん |